How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Rossmoor?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Rossmoor Studio Apartments | $1,881 | $1,675 | $2,015 |
Rossmoor 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,881 | $1,225 | $3,007 |
Rossmoor 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,106 | $1,610 | $5,209 |
Rossmoor 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,603 | $2,200 | $3,995 |

Getting Around the Rossmoor Neighborhood in Silver Spring, MD
Walk Score®
42 / 100
Car-Dependent
Most errands require a car
Bike Score®
41 / 100
Somewhat Bikeable
Minimal b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
3 / 100
Minimal Transit
It may be possible to get on a bus
